21xrx.com
2024-11-22 04:00:57 Friday
登录
文章检索 我的文章 写文章
C++ 二叉树模板:快速实现二叉树算法
2023-06-29 18:25:37 深夜i     --     --
C++ 二叉树 模板 快速实现 算法

C++ 二叉树模板是一种能够快速实现二叉树算法的工具。由于二叉树在计算机科学中有广泛的应用,因此有一个高效的二叉树模板对于程序员来说是非常有用的。

利用 C++ 二叉树模板,实现二叉树算法会变得非常简单,因为该模板封装了重要的数据结构和算法。使用本模板,程序员可以轻松创建一个二叉树,添加节点,删除节点,以及遍历树的各个部分。此外,它还提供了一些常见的二叉树算法,例如查找树是否平衡,计算树的高度,寻找最大的节点和最小的节点。

C++ 二叉树模板也非常适合那些没有太多数据结构编程经验的程序员。该模板提供了详细的文档和例子,帮助新手快速上手。此外,由于 C++ 二叉树模板是开源的,因此程序员可以自由修改和定制该模板来满足他们的特定需求。

虽然 C++ 二叉树模板非常有用,但还是需要谨慎使用。因为该模板使用递归算法,因此如果树非常大,可能会导致内存问题。此外,由于 C++ 二叉树模板是开源的,因此可能存在一些错误和缺陷。因此,在使用 C++ 二叉树模板时,程序员应该谨慎测试,并查阅其文档和在线社区,以寻找可能存在的问题或解决方案。

总之,C++ 二叉树模板是一个十分有用的工具,特别是对于那些需要处理大量二叉树数据结构的程序员。该模板提供了通用的算法,又易于定制,对于提高程序员的效率和代码的可读性都将起到重要的作用。同时,程序员需要谨慎使用,以避免出现内存问题和错误。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复